Electricians in Torrox - where local knowledge and rural experience matter most

The electrician market around Torrox reflects the character of the Axarquia - smaller, more word-of-mouth dependent, and with a higher proportion of rural and traditional property work than the western Costa del Sol. Finding a registered Instalador Electrico Autorizado who covers your specific location - whether that is a coastal apartment, a village house in Torrox Pueblo, or a rural finca nearby - requires knowing where to look and what to ask.

Electrical challenges specific to Torrox properties

  • Off-grid and solar systems - rural properties around Torrox frequently rely on solar panels and battery storage systems. Finding an electrician with genuine off-grid system experience is important - not all registered electricians have this specialist knowledge.
  • Outdated rural installations - many older fincas and cortijos have electrical installations that are decades old and significantly below current Spanish standards. A full assessment and rewire is often needed before additional work can be added legally.
  • Single-phase supply limitations - rural properties around Torrox sometimes have limited supply capacity that restricts what can be installed without upgrading the incoming supply. An experienced local electrician will assess this before quoting.
  • Access and travel costs - electricians based in Nerja or Velez-Malaga who cover Torrox Pueblo and rural properties charge for travel time. For remote properties, this adds to call-out costs and affects availability for non-urgent work.

What to check before hiring an electrician in Torrox

  • Carnet de Instalador Electrico Autorizado - check the category and expiry date
  • Specific experience with off-grid solar systems if your property uses one
  • Certificado de Instalacion Electrica confirmed as part of the service for any significant work
  • Valid seguro de responsabilidad civil
  • Ask the electrician to visit the property before quoting for any significant work - rural site conditions significantly affect what is needed and what it costs

Electrician costs in Torrox in 2026

  • Standard call-out, coastal towns, first hour: 80 to 150 euros
  • Rural property call-out with travel supplement: 110 to 220 euros total
  • Consumer unit replacement: 400 to 850 euros including certification
  • Air conditioning installation, single split unit: 800 to 1,700 euros
  • Off-grid solar system, small rural property: 5,000 to 10,000 euros depending on capacity and battery storage
  • Full rewire, rural finca: 4,000 to 12,000 euros depending on size and condition
